Active Start Active Future: an early intervention targeting physical activity participation and sedentary behaviour in young children with cerebral palsy

Welcome to Active Start Active Future!  Are you interested in your child with cerebral palsy being move active? We can help.  We know all young children should be active, at least 60 minutes each day for good health and well-being. The benefits include:

  • Develop muscles and bones,
  • Build relationships and social skills,
  • Helps brain development and learning,
  • Encourages movement and co-ordination,
  • Improves sleep, and
  • Maintains health and weight.

Unfortunately, children with cerebral palsy are less active than their peers and are also more sedentary (sit more) and we want to address this early.

As a parent, you have a critical role in helping your children to be active.

We want to test an early childhood intervention ‘Active Start Active Future’ which aims to help you and your family support your child’s physical activity, and, consider your own physical activity. The program will use coaching, motivational interviewing, teach physical skills and promote strategies to reduce barriers to physical activity and sedentary behaviour for young children with CP at home, in their community including at pre/schools.

We aim to recruit 40 children aged 3-7 years classified in Gross Motor Function Classification System levels II-V (children who walk through to children who need support to move) to either immediate Active Start or Wait List control (receive the intervention after 6 months).

The physiotherapist will visit you once a week, for 8 weeks with 24 week follow up (no travelling for you and its free!).

Our program is designed to empower families to access additional or new physical activity opportunities across a range of settings and to value physical activity as a lifelong choice.
